S5:E2 Drug Affordability: The High Cost of Healing

Season 5 · Episode 2

mardi 22 octobre 2024Duration 43:08

Prescription drug prices in the United States are 2.78 times higher than in other developed countries, but why?

We untangle the barriers surrounding drug affordability and find out why accessing life-saving medications is costly to so many. Joined by experts, advocates, and one Cystic Fibrosis patient relying on expensive medication to live, we examine the complex factors contributing to the high costs of drugs, from research and development to pricing strategies and supply chain dynamics. We also investigate potential solutions to improve access and affordability without compromising on drug innovation.

S4:E5 Unlocking the Dark Genome for Lupus and Other Autoimmune Diseases

Season 4 · Episode 5

mardi 2 avril 2024Duration 43:51

Autoimmune diseases like lupus impact over 5 million patients globally, but treatment options remain limited. Now, decoding the once mysterious "dark genome" could bring new therapies. Over 90% of our DNA was once considered "junk"—but we’ve learned this dark matter regulates gene expression and human disease. This episode takes you to the pioneers who are unlocking the dark genome's potential to correct root causes of complex conditions like lupus. We'll chat with those illuminating this uncharted territory and developing novel approaches.
